The name E&O is a name synonymous with timeless elegance and refinement. Inspired by the rich heritage of the legendary 19th century Eastern & Oriental Hotel in Penang from which the Group takes its name, the Bursa Malaysia main-board listed company has interests in 3 core business activities namely property development, hospitality and lifestyle and property investment.

Property Development

With a reputation as a premier lifestyle property developer built across a series of exclusive addresses in Kuala Lumpur and Penang Island, E&O has a track record that includes prestigious residential projects like Sri Se-Ekar, 202 Desa Cahaya and Kampung Warisan the latter of which was successfully conceptualised as a traditional Malay village ambience in the heart of Kuala Lumpur.

More recent landmark developments in Kuala Lumpur include the signature Seventy Damansara and Idamansara, both located in the upscale Damansara Heights, the high-end condominium Dua Residency located within the vicinity of the Kuala Lumpur City Centre (KLCC) and the Manhattan-style metro condominiums of St Mary Residences in the heart of the Central Business District (CBD).

On Penang Island, E&O’s master planned seafront development Seri Tanjung Pinang is one of the most sought-after residential addresses among locals and expatriates on the island especially with its latest launch, the Andaman at Quayside, a sea fronting resort condominium and the first in the region to offer a 4.5-acre private waterpark for residents.

E&O is currently making its foray into Johor with the development of an iconic wellness township in the Heritage Cluster in Medini Central of the Nusajaya flagship zone of Iskandar Malaysia. The 210-acre development, also known as the Medini Integrated Wellness Capital is strategically located 15 minutes from the Tuas Second Link to Singapore. Built around the concept of “Living in the Heart of Wellness”, it is a sanctuary centred upon the ideology of preventive wellness to prolong one’s active years.

Hospitality and Lifestyle

E&O undertook the meticulous refurbishment and upgrading of the heritage Eastern & Oriental Hotel (E&O Hotel) and Lone Pine Hotel in the late 1990s. Since established by the Sarkies Brothers in 1885, E&O Hotel has charmed travellers from near and far by creating a reputation to match its sister hotels – The Raffles, Singapore and The Strand, Rangoon.

Established in 1948, Lone Pine Hotel is the oldest beach hotel along Penang Island’s Batu Ferringhi tourist strip. Due to the Group’s hotel management expertise, there are ongoing efforts to capitalise and extend this service through the management of a portfolio of hotels and resorts in Malaysia and around the region.

E&O owns The Delicious Group which operates restaurants in some of the most vibrant spots of Kuala Lumpur, Penang and Singapore. The outlet in Penang’s Straits Quay festive retail marina marks the Group’s first foray outside Kuala Lumpur while the Scotts Square, Singapore outlet is the first outside Malaysia.

Property Investment

To gain capital appreciation and sustained yields, E&O has rental income derived from investments in its own residential units, commercial and retail space. These include the retail podium at St Mary Residences, a joint venture development with 3 high-rise towers of 650 units of exclusive service apartments in Kuala Lumpur’s CBD; Dua Annexe, the lifestyle-driven boutique complex located at the annexe block adjacent to the Dua Residency condominium; the 12-acre Straits Quay, set around a vibrant marina at the heart of the Seri Tanjung Pinang 1,000-acre master planned seafront development.
